Proverbs 24

“By wisdom a house is built, and by understanding it is established; by knowledge the rooms are filled with all precious and pleasant riches” (v3-4). “A house,” a stable and fruitful life, is built by wisdom and understanding. The true “precious and pleasant riches” that fill the rooms of our lives are generosity and kindness, self-control and sacrifice, obedience to the Lord and endurance (v10). God’s ways of integrity, faithful work, and the willingness to help others give us a framework for a good life (v11, 26, 27).

“For by wise guidance you can wage your war” (v6). Even if we stumble, God’s Word and His Spirit give us everything we need to face our battles and be victorious (v11).
